> i40iw_l2param_change() is never called in atomic context.
> 
> i40iw_make_listen_node() is only set as ".l2_param_change" 
> in struct i40e_client_ops, and this function pointer is not called 
> in atomic context.
> 
> Despite never getting called from atomic context,
> i40iw_l2param_change() calls kzalloc() with GFP_ATOMIC,
> which does not sleep for allocation.
> GFP_ATOMIC is not necessary and can be replaced with GFP_KERNEL,
> which can sleep and improve the possibility of sucessful allocation.
> 
> This is found by a static analysis tool named DCNS written by myself.
> And I also manually check it.
